Creating Flipped Classroom Videos with Camtasia (Mac)

Sign up or log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

This workshop is designed for teachers that interested in the flipped classroom concept but do not know where to start. We will start with the basics of how to get started with screencasting. With hands-on guidance and demonstrations, participants will learn how easy it is to record, edit and share their flipped lessons using Camtasia (a free copy of Camtasia for Mac will be provided to each attendee). Participants will learn to create, organize and present crisp, professionally-pleasing screencasts. Other topics to be covered include:

  • Overview of the flipped class approach and when it should (and should not) be used
  • Flipped classroom myths
  • How to manage a flipped class
  • Pen-based input tools (Tablet PC, Electronic Whiteboard, USB Tablets, etc.)
  • Tips on microphones and recording high quality audio
